All overlays, or just face overlays?

NiOverride has a problem with face overlays causing a CTD during decapitation. Thus all face overlays are currently disabled, for now.

I have absolutely no idea what "mod loader" would be. There is no such tool that I know of, or could find by searching trough Google.

Load order is important, because it determines what files will take final effects in the game. This is why it is important to sort it out with LOOT.

If you suspect that there is indeed something wrong in files in your SKSE folder, then ...SKSE > Plugins > nioverride.ini should be the first file to check. That would be the one controlling basic appearance of overlays.
